Ctek is tried and true as a reliable tender for lead acid batteries. Just plug it in and forget it until spring.
Only crazy motorsport types like me use 5 lb lithium batteries that require special care and feeding.

I don't recommend leaving them in your car at all for winterizing but rather remove and store separately. I have a NOCO battery charger maintainer designed to charge lead acid, AGM, and lithium, batteries with their specific needs. The trouble is, this is a very smart charger with microprocessor technology to sense your battery type and condition. In a power outage it may lose it's memory and software crash... no charging taking place at all. I like it but keep it in the garage where I keep a close eye on it.
